Akamai researchers disclosed NoaBot, a Mirai-derived wormable botnet used since early 2023 for a global cryptomining campaign. NoaBot brute-forces SSH via dictionary attacks to insert SSH public keys and enable lateral movement, can download/execute additional binaries, and deploys an obfuscated variant of the XMRig miner that hides its pool/wallet; 849 victim IPs were observed with a notable concentration in China. The campaign shows links to other IoT/router-targeting malware (P2PInfect) and the report recommends restricting internet-facing SSH and using strong passwords.
